Students must successfully complete: 18 core courses, 4 specialisation courses and a capstone project
Credits: 240 ECTS
Business Environment
Resource Management
Communication Skills
People in Organisations
Administrative Services
Personal & Professional Development
Managing Communication
Business Organisations in a Global Context
People Management
Finance for Managers
Employability Skills
Business Ethics
Planning a New Business Venture
Risk Management
Customer Relationship Management
Leadership & Management
Managing Quality and Service Delivery
Personal Leadership & Management Development
Financial Decision Making for Managers
Accounting
Managing Finance in the Public Sector
Economics for Business
